What Ceianna Means

Likely a modern invented name, possibly a combination of 'Ceia' and 'Anna'. 'Anna' is of Hebrew origin, meaning 'grace'.

Ceianna is likely a modern invented name, possibly a fusion of a sound like 'Ceia' with the Hebrew name 'Anna', which means 'grace'. This name first appeared in the records in 2004, existing as a singular entry for that year.
